Decade after Hayman fire, questions linger about fire’s start
Ten years after the biggest fire in the state’s worst fire season — which famously prompted then-Gov. Bill Owens to declare, “It looks as if all of Colorado is burning” — not one important detail of Forest Service employee Terry Barton’s account of the fire’s beginnings is uncontested.
Ten years after, it is still unclear exactly how the Hayman fire started.
Or why.
